背景:
有时候我们需要在不同的项目提交代码,并使用不同的用户名称,比如自己的 git 仓库和公司项目的仓库对用户名的要求不一样。
1. 设置一个全局的用户名
git config --global user.name Misssusu
git config --global user.email Misssusu@xxx.com
此时的配置被写到~/.gitconfig
配置文件
2. 在某个项目根目录配置私有的用户名
git config user.name Misssusu
git config user.email Misssusu@xxx.com
此时的配置被写到当前项目下的.git/config
文件